Gate Ventures 研究洞察:Layer2 時(shí)代下 流動性割裂問題的研究
引言
自從Ethereum轉(zhuǎn)向以Layer2為核心的擴(kuò)展方案,加上RaaS等工具的興起,大量公鏈迅速發(fā)展。許多實(shí)體都希望構(gòu)建自己的鏈,以代表不同的利益訴求并尋求更高的估值。然而,眾多公鏈的涌現(xiàn)使得生態(tài)系統(tǒng)的發(fā)展難以跟上公鏈的步伐,導(dǎo)致許多項(xiàng)目在TGE時(shí)即告破發(fā)。
借助OPStack,Coinbase推出了自己的BaseLayer2,Kraken發(fā)布了Ink;借助ZK技術(shù),OKX推出了XLayer;Sony發(fā)布了Soneium,LINE推出了Kaia等。如今,構(gòu)建一條鏈的資金和技術(shù)門檻已大大降低,運(yùn)營一條基于OPStack的鏈的成本每月約為10,000美元。
未來必將是多鏈共存的時(shí)代。盡管這些Layer2鏈可能會選擇EVM兼容性以實(shí)現(xiàn)互通,但由于其背后的Web2實(shí)體有大量下游應(yīng)用,它們很難在同一條鏈上構(gòu)建應(yīng)用并達(dá)成共識。

ChainAbstractionStack,Source:Frontier Research
我們使用的業(yè)界較為認(rèn)可的Cake架構(gòu)來從上至下介紹跨鏈抽象的核心組件構(gòu)成:
應(yīng)用層(ApplicationLayer)
這是用戶直接交互的層,也是流動性解決方案中最抽象的一層,因?yàn)樗耆帘瘟肆鲃有赞D(zhuǎn)換的細(xì)節(jié)。在應(yīng)用層中,用戶與前端界面互動,未必了解底層的流動性轉(zhuǎn)換機(jī)制。
權(quán)限層(PermissionLayer)
位于應(yīng)用層下方,用戶通過連接錢包到dApp并請求報(bào)價(jià)來滿足交易意圖。這里的「意圖」指的是用戶期望的最終交易結(jié)果(即輸出),而非交易的具體執(zhí)行路徑。
賬戶管理和抽象層(KeyManagementandAccountAbstraction)
由于多鏈環(huán)境的存在,需要一個(gè)適應(yīng)不同鏈的賬戶管理和抽象體系來維護(hù)各個(gè)鏈的獨(dú)特賬戶結(jié)構(gòu)。例如,SUI的對象中心賬戶體系與EVM完全不同。OneBalance是該領(lǐng)域的代表項(xiàng)目,它構(gòu)建了可信的賬戶體系,無需建立鏈間共識,只需現(xiàn)有賬戶體系之間的可信承諾。NearAccount通過為用戶生成多鏈賬戶錢包來實(shí)現(xiàn)抽象化管理,極大地優(yōu)化了用戶體驗(yàn),減少了UX的碎片化。然而,流動性方面主要集成了現(xiàn)有的公鏈。
求解層(SolverLayer)
該層負(fù)責(zé)接收并實(shí)現(xiàn)用戶的交易意圖,Solver角色在這里競爭以提供更好的用戶體驗(yàn),包括更快的交易時(shí)間和執(zhí)行速度。在此基礎(chǔ)上,基于意圖的項(xiàng)目如Anoma,構(gòu)建了各種意圖驅(qū)動的解決方案。此類意圖的衍生品如Predicate組件,可在特定規(guī)則下實(shí)現(xiàn)用戶意圖。
結(jié)算層(SettlementLayer)
這是求解層為實(shí)現(xiàn)用戶意圖而使用的中間件層。流動性和狀態(tài)分散的解決方案核心組件包括:
預(yù)言機(jī)(Oracle):用于獲取其他鏈上的狀態(tài)信息。
跨鏈橋(Bridges):負(fù)責(zé)跨鏈的信息和流動性傳遞。
提前確認(rèn)方案(Pre-Confirmation):縮短跨鏈確認(rèn)時(shí)間。
數(shù)據(jù)可用性(DA):提供數(shù)據(jù)的可訪問性。
此外,還需考慮鏈間流動性、最終確認(rèn)性(Finality)、Layer2證明機(jī)制等因素,以保障整個(gè)多鏈系統(tǒng)的高效運(yùn)作。解決方案
當(dāng)前,市面上有多種解決流動性割裂的解決方案,我們縱覽了大量方案后,發(fā)現(xiàn)主要是有這幾種方式:
1.以RaaS為中心:類似于OPStack這種Rollup解決方案,通過加入特定的共享排序器和跨鏈橋來協(xié)助在OPStack上構(gòu)建的Rollup共享流動性和狀態(tài)。這希望能夠以一個(gè)更高層次的方向去解決流動性和狀態(tài)分散。這里面有一個(gè)較為細(xì)分的就是單獨(dú)的設(shè)計(jì)共享排序器,這個(gè)方案更多的是針對Layer2,不具備普適性,如Astria、Espresso和Flashbots等。

INFINITStructure,source: Infinit
INFINIT構(gòu)建了一個(gè)DeFi屆的RaaS服務(wù),其能夠?yàn)镈eFi協(xié)議提供直接構(gòu)建所需要的組件,如Oracle、PoolType、IRM、Asset等,還能夠提供立刻啟用的LeverageTrading和YieldStrategy等組件。相當(dāng)于其它應(yīng)用構(gòu)建端,但是最終的流動性是放在Infinit的流動性層。但是,目前其仍然未披露底層的工作原理。目前INFINIT已經(jīng)獲得了RobotVentures,ElectricCapital以及MaelstromCapital等的600萬美元種子輪融資。KhalaniNetwork

LiquoriceStructure,source:Liquorice
Liquorice是一款去中心化應(yīng)用程序,可實(shí)現(xiàn)基于拍賣的價(jià)格發(fā)現(xiàn)和單邊流動性池。Liquorice的主要使命是為專業(yè)交易公司提供高效的庫存管理工具,并在使用意圖結(jié)算交易時(shí)輕松連接到1inch和UniswapX等核心DeFi協(xié)議與此同時(shí),Liquorice創(chuàng)建了借貸市場,供其進(jìn)行借貸交易。這款應(yīng)用更加專注于交易本身。目前仍然在開發(fā)階段,其在7月份宣布獲得來自GreenField領(lǐng)投的120萬美元Pre-seed輪融資。Xion
Xion是由Burnt品牌升級而來,過去Burnt是專注于消費(fèi)者應(yīng)用程序的應(yīng)用,之后團(tuán)隊(duì)發(fā)現(xiàn)鏈上交互存在極大的碎片化的問題,因此構(gòu)建了Xion以改進(jìn)這一問題。Xion是建立在CometBFT共識協(xié)議之上的。其采用的跨鏈通信是基于CosmosIBC的,因此比其它跨鏈橋更加的原生、安全。其共進(jìn)行過四輪融資,投資人有Animoca、Multicoin、AllianceDAO、Mechanism等。=nil;Foundation
nil是Ethereum的ZK算力市場、ZK協(xié)處理器和Layer2的開發(fā)商,團(tuán)隊(duì)具備深厚的ZK技術(shù)功底。提出了zkSharding解決方案,該解決方案是使用ZK技術(shù)來水平拓展以太主網(wǎng),執(zhí)行分片并行處理交易并生成ZKP,而主分片驗(yàn)證數(shù)據(jù)、與Ethereum通信并在所有驗(yàn)證者之間同步網(wǎng)絡(luò)狀態(tài)。主分片還管理執(zhí)行分片中驗(yàn)證者和賬戶的分布。驗(yàn)證委員會使用的共識協(xié)議也是Hotstuff,這在最新的并行執(zhí)行的項(xiàng)目中很常見。=nil;L2從一開始就將跨分片通信嵌入到協(xié)議中。跨分片消息由每個(gè)分片的驗(yàn)證者委員會驗(yàn)證為交易。
其基本想法就是,通過分片的Layer2架構(gòu),來構(gòu)建類似于IBC一樣內(nèi)嵌的跨分片通信架構(gòu),這樣就能解決流動性和狀態(tài)分散的問題。但是其核心想法并不合理,因?yàn)榱鲃有苑稚⒔鉀Q的問題是多鏈的問題,其構(gòu)建的是單一的Layer2,意思是想要解決就需要所有鏈都成為ZK-sharding的一個(gè)分片,這難以實(shí)現(xiàn)。ERC-7683
ERC-7683,source: Across
Ethereum也正在著手解決這一跨鏈流動性的問題,目前Arbitrum、OP、Uniswap首先公開支持ERC7683標(biāo)準(zhǔn),其使用的也是基于Intent的跨鏈方式。其核心目標(biāo)是為跨L2和側(cè)鏈的跨鏈操作建立通用標(biāo)準(zhǔn),標(biāo)準(zhǔn)化訂單和結(jié)算接口,實(shí)現(xiàn)無縫跨鏈執(zhí)行,其主要的核心就是一個(gè)Filler也可以說是鏈抽象中的Solver角色代付。該提案是由Uniswap和Across共同構(gòu)建的,目前正在被Cake工作組審查。OPStack
OPStack、ERC-7683、和zkSharding一樣,都是Ethereum內(nèi)部針對Layer2之間的流動性碎片化的解決方案,分別是架構(gòu)層面、共識層面、應(yīng)用層面去解決的。OPStack通過設(shè)計(jì)一個(gè)完整的多Layer2解決方案,來一次性解決信息傳遞和Sequencer去中心化的問題,當(dāng)你使用OPStack架構(gòu)時(shí),便會自動部署跨鏈合約,同時(shí)會存在一個(gè)Supervisor去挑戰(zhàn)避免傳遞虛假跨鏈信息。目前使用OPStack架構(gòu)的有Coinbase、Uniswap、Kraken等。
其中,比較典型的就是Unichain。Unichain主要通過與Superchain網(wǎng)絡(luò)的集成來解決跨鏈流動性碎片化問題。此設(shè)置通過提供以下功能促進(jìn)無縫的流動性移動:
基于意圖的跨鏈橋:該橋支持快速可靠的Blockchain間流動性轉(zhuǎn)移,允許用戶設(shè)定意圖,從而幫助系統(tǒng)自動選擇最佳路徑進(jìn)行流動性移動。這種方法為用戶抽象掉了復(fù)雜性,使得跨鏈交易更加順暢和快捷。
Unichain驗(yàn)證網(wǎng)絡(luò)(UVN):這個(gè)去中心化節(jié)點(diǎn)運(yùn)營商網(wǎng)絡(luò)驗(yàn)證跨鏈交易,提供更快的經(jīng)濟(jì)最終確定性。更快的最終確定對于確保高效結(jié)算跨鏈交易至關(guān)重要,從而最大限度地減少因延遲結(jié)算導(dǎo)致的流動性碎片化風(fēng)險(xiǎn)。
Flashblocks和可驗(yàn)證區(qū)塊構(gòu)建:通過使用Flashblocks,Unichain顯著縮短了區(qū)塊時(shí)間,提高了流動性提供者效率,并實(shí)現(xiàn)了更同步的跨鏈?zhǔn)袌觥lashblocks有助于確保流動性能隨時(shí)獲得并減少因區(qū)塊確認(rèn)延遲造成的負(fù)面影響,這可能會導(dǎo)致流動性的碎片化。總結(jié)
解決跨鏈流動性的問題,是一個(gè)非常龐雜且解決方案繁多的領(lǐng)域,比如Layer2的解決方案分為從Ethereum內(nèi)嵌跨鏈消息特別是ERC-7683來解決,還有Layer2如OP構(gòu)建的OPStack來共享Sequencer來解決。脫離Layer2語境下,所有的Layer1也都面臨流動性、狀態(tài)、用戶體驗(yàn)割裂的問題,有專門針對于流動性的應(yīng)用為中心的解決方案,也有以SolverNetwork的鏈下解決方案,乃至還有類似NEAR這種賬戶為中心的解決方案,但是也需要基于Solver這種鏈下的角色。
我們較為認(rèn)可,跨鏈流動性、狀態(tài)、用戶體驗(yàn)割裂是整個(gè)Blockchain行業(yè)的問題,如果從整體上思考,需要以一個(gè)更加抽象,類似于鏈抽象的方式去做,這相當(dāng)于是真正的Web3的入口,解決了用戶體驗(yàn)上的割裂,同時(shí)流動性和狀態(tài)的整合在用戶無法感知的地方去做。具體如何整合,又被分為使用鏈下的Solver網(wǎng)絡(luò)和原子性的整合跨鏈橋等設(shè)施,這都值得去探討的。總的來說,未來一定是多鏈的,解決流動性分散的問題是一個(gè)行業(yè)在必然要面臨的問題,而這種全鏈流動性的整合存在廣袤的成長空間,有可能構(gòu)建出Web3時(shí)代的Google。
